Maggie Hadleigh-West


In 1991 Maggie Hadleigh-West made the first film on sexual harassment in public called War Zone. It garnered world-wide attention and became a feature in 1998. Sick to Death! is her fourth film and second documentary. Her work is often thought to be controversial, provocative, radical and irreverent. Through her company, YoMaggie Productions, LLC, and the mediums of film, television, and public speaking, Maggie focuses on developing social justice projects related to various forms of “violence”, which have been previously unrecognized or under-examined. She’s a 2017 Impact Doc Awards winner, a 2013 Guggenheim Fellow Award Winner, 2010 Indie Fest: Audience Impact Merit Award Winner, 2010 Accolade Merit Award Winner, 2009, 2006 and 2005 Alcyon Foundation Fellow, a 2004 New York State Council on the Arts Fellow, 2001 University of Louisville Distinguished Professor Nominee, 2000 Rockefeller Fellow Nominee and a 1998 Berlin Film Festival Caligari Nominee. http://sick2death.com/
